## Transport: Survey Instrument Crate

Crate TQ-7 holds calibrated theodolites from Marrowfield Geomatics, bound for the Dunhollow site office. Foam-packed, do not stack. Keep upright; tilt sensors fitted inside the lid. Courier from Larkspan Logistics collects at the east dock between 14:00 and 15:00. Verify seal intact before release and log the time on the dock sheet. The hand-over instruction below is confidential and must be followed exactly.

handover note for yagef-bagep: the drudor pelius courier leaves the kasdor zorvan norir ledger at gate 8016 under passcode 755406

**Mgmt Meeting Minutes — Retiring the Brightline Range**

Quick recap for sales leads at Fenholt Supplies: we agreed to retire the Brightline fixture range by year-end. Remaining stock moves to clearance pricing next month, and accounts on standing orders get migrated to the Lumetta range. Trade-in incentives were approved in principle. The confidential note on next steps sits just below.

board note of bajof-bajeg: The pricing group signed off on a budget of $13.4 million for Project Sildor. The renewal with Lamixek Holdings closes at $48.9 million a year, 49 percent above the last contract.

Release managers should always promote them as a pair, since the dispatch protocol version is negotiated at startup and mismatches cause silent fallback to the legacy algorithm, which skews benchmark results. Before promoting to the shared benchmarking environment, verify the scenario seed registry has been synced and that the previous run's artifacts are archived. The configuration values the promotion script applies to the benchmarking environment are as follows.

settings of yafog-kagep:
NOVVAN_PIN=8841
NOVVAN_TENANT=pelwyn
NOVVAN_METRICS_HOST=metrics.novvan.orvexforge.example
NOVVAN_SEAL=seal_30060f3e
NOVVAN_STANDBY_TEAM=wenox